In partnership with Intuition Training, we are delighted to be able to offer a free, flexible, unit-by-unit remote training initiative for our members who want to make progress to achieve their Cert CII for a maximum of 10 learners (worth £150 per learner).

Training structure

The cost of this training (usually £150 per learner) will be fully funded by the Insurance Institute of Chelmsford & South Essex for a maximum of ten members for one module per member subject to the eligibility criteria stated below. The modules available and their start dates and duration are available below:

Cert CII training groups will be maximum 25 learners from across the Chartered Insurance Institute membership to enable interactive and engaging sessions.

Interactive training sessions for the units will involve going through the chapters in detail, including end of chapter questions to develop a broad understanding of the syllabus. Revision sessions will focus on mock exams and revision quizzes allowing learners to build confidence to take their exam.

All learners will receive a broad range of training & revision materials such as end-of-chapter questions, mock exams and revision quizzes, designed by Adrian to support preparation towards the exam. As well as the materials used in the sessions, learners will also receive an additional bank of mock exams.

All sessions will be recorded to allow learners to re-listen as part of their studies.

In order to be eligible for funding, the Insurance Institute of Chelmsford & South Essex will be reviewing applicant submissions based on the following criteria:

  • The applicant must be an active member of the CII with their Local Institute being the Insurance Institute of Chelmsford & South Essex
  • The applicant must not have availability of support or funding for similar training sessions from other avenues i.e. through an apprenticeship scheme from their employer or a self-funded opportunity
  • Applicants must be available for all sessions for the module training being delivered
  • Applicants must be able to evidence the support of their line manager to complete the training
  • Applicants must have already registered for the module and have study materials ready ahead of the training start date
  • A short personal statement (maximum 300 words) is encouraged in the event of a large pool of applications being received.
